To remove a recessed light cover, first turn off the power to the light. Then, gently push up on the cover to release it from the clips holding it in place. Carefully lower the cover and set it aside.

How can I remove a recessed light can?

To remove a recessed light can, first turn off the power to the light fixture. Then, remove the light bulb and trim from the fixture. Next, unscrew the screws holding the fixture in place and carefully pull the can out of the ceiling. Disconnect the wires and remove the can from the ceiling.

How can I use a can light adapter to convert a recessed light fixture into a pendant light fixture?

To convert a recessed light fixture into a pendant light fixture using a can light adapter, you will need to remove the existing recessed light trim and bulb, then install the can light adapter into the recessed housing. Next, attach the pendant light fixture to the adapter according to the manufacturer's instructions. Finally, adjust the pendant light height and secure it in place to complete the conversion.
